don't take the risk of hiding prohibited goods and make sure you don't accidently leave some in your van and car. The SA staff are generally not as vigilant as the WA ones and they've never check our tow vehicle - just our van and they always make for the fridge - we've never had cupboards opened. I suspect its because of the State cut-back on staff - theres often not more than one person there and there is no protection from rain like the WA check point.

Last time we went into SA we accidently had a pile of fresh fruit and veg in the crisper baskets of the van fridge. The inspector opened the baskets, but for some reason didn't see them (they weren't in bags) and we drove on through with the offending goods
